DLCA Announces Revised Hours of Operation on St. Thomas

Department of Licensing and Consumer Affairs (DLCA) Commissioner Nominee Richard T. Evangelista Esq.

The Department of Licensing and Consumer Affairs (DLCA) informs the public that DLCA office located at the Property and Procurement Building, 8201 Sub Base, Suite 1, St. Thomas, will be operating on a revised schedule until further notice. These revised hours are 9 a.m. to 4 p.m., Monday through Friday, commencing on Wednesday, May 7.

The St. Croix and St. John offices will continue to operate doing its regular business hours from 8 a.m. to 5 p.m. and can be reached at 713-3522 on St. Croix or 693-8036 on St. John.
